Club Cali is closing

January 28th, 2006  |  by Simon  |  published in Clothes, Shopping

What am I gonna do?!!!
I buy a lot of my shirts and t-shirts at Hollister when I’m out in Dallas. Club Cali is basically their loyalty programme which gives you points for every $ you spend. Save up enough points and you get gift certificates and other stuff. You also get invited to concerts and [...]
